We just returned from a week of dining.
(Not free dining - we actually stay offsite).

9/9 - NINE DRAGONS in EPCOT was terrific! Service was wonderful. We did the dinner for two - honey sesame chicken and shrimp and vegetable. Everything was delicious! Dd had the fried rice kids meal.

9/10 - CRYSTAL PALACE at MK was awful. It went from being our favorite buffet to doubtful we'll go back for many many years. We had actually planned to celebrate dd's 4th birthday with Pooh and thank goodness we had a backup plan for later in the week. We arrived just before 5 for our 5pm dinner reservations. We were finally seated after 5:30PM. People were very upset and as you can imagine the little kids were getting restless waiting outside for so long. I mentioned to the hostess we were celebrating dd's 4th birthday and she didn't even look up. When we were seated there was mickey confetti on the table and dd received a birthday card signed by the characters. I was celebrating my birthday on Wednesday the 12th and asked to make sure this day was all about dd and not focused on my birthday. Oh well, they gave me a card too. The food was bad and the options were very limited compared to last year. And the character interaction was shameful. I actually heard a CM tell the family behind us to hurry up and take the picture because Piglet has to go. It was sad. I think the big reason we pay for character meals is the hope for 2 minutes of time. So then the big disappointment. Another kid received a cupcake and half the restaurant sang to him. Dd was getting excited. And out came two cupcakes for us and our waitress slowly sang Happy Birthday. No audience participation for us. Of course the biggest disappointment was no birthday cake. I ordered it three weeks prior and was so mad when I saw the cupcakes I didn't say a thing. There was no point in mentioning it because who cares about cake after you started eating a cupcake. It was totally unspecial. I bit my tongue because I didn't want to ruin it for dd. She was happy with her cupcake.

9/11 - WOLFGANG PUCK in DTD was amazing as always. Dh had the macadamia nut crust chicken and I had springs rolls and caesar salad (more then enough for a meal). Dd had to send hers back since their version of mac n cheese isn't what she had in mind - LOL.

9/12 - 1900 PARK FARE in GF was finally the birthday celebration we were waiting for. Hats off to our waitress Patti who made the night very memorable. The food was great, the selection was wonderful, and the character interaction couldn't be better. Cinderella was amazing and my dd loved talking with her. And Patti brought us birthday crowns and big cupcakes. She had the restaurant sing Happy Birthday to us and dd got a special birthday placemat signed by the characters. It was awesome!

9/13 - HOLLYWOOD & VINE in MGM was very expensive for lunch. The character interaction was very good but the restaurant was barely 1/2 full. The buffet was very limited compared to our last visit in December. Fun for sure, but in my opinion not worth the money.

9/14 - RAINFOREST CAFE in DTD was great. We were ready for a good cheeseburger!

9/15 - NINE DRAGONS in EPCOT for lunch. It's our favorite restaurant!

Hi MomPlanner22,
The character interaction was great at H&V but the restaurant was only 1/2 full. My dd didn't like JoJo. My dh and I both thought she looked a little funny (strange pink circles around her eyes). Of course the Little Einsteins looked a little strange with their big heads too. But we spent 2-3 minutes with Goliath twice. So we laughed and said, no biggee we spent some extra money for a photo session with a cute lion :goodvibes .

In terms of food, we were disappointed the carving station was gone. We both ate salad and I can't remember anything else on the menu that I thought was good. The desserts were the same thing you normally see at buffets. The kids area was the usual mac n cheese and other kid food. Actually I had better luck finding food at the kids area. The meatballs were pretty good.

It was fun overall, especially since Goliath was so great. But I could have seen him on Mickey Ave. that afternoon. Maybe it would be best to try their breakfast (maybe a late seating for bunch)? I know all the breakfast buffets have basically the same food - mickey waffles, pancakes, eggs, bacon, etc.
